WHAT IS VISUAL POETRY?

This is usually poetry written in an intentional form to emphasize the words of the poem. It employs the use of some or all visual art elements – line, shape, value, colour, form, space, texture – to symbolize the intended effect of the words.

PROCESS WORK 2

Work with a partner. Share your 12 thumbnails.

From feedback from your partner, choose your best four thumbnails for your final designs. Use the following criteria to support your decisions.

Criteria

1. Which thumbnail best shows the words in the shape of the image.

2. Which group of thumbnails would best show unity.

3. How can a thumbnail design be improved? Be nice, be constructive. Use the elements of art (line, shape, colour, space, texture, value, form) to support your ideas.

FINAL PROJECT

Complete your images on the paper provided. Draw all four images first.

Criteria

Shape or form of the image is created and emphasized by typeface (font).

The images show value and depth.

The images are unified by art element(s), and not just by theme or idea.

Chosen fonts show variety in shape and size.

Book making technique shows outstanding craftsmanship.
